Warriors’ Kerr Updates Status Of Durant, Thompson And Iguodala

The Golden State Warriors are plagued with injuries, and head coach Steve Kerr provided an update on the condition of his top players.

Kevin Durant won’t join his team in Game 3 of the NBA Finals. Kerr confirmed that Durant won’t play against the Toronto Raptors Wednesday as he still recovers from the calf strain he earned in the game against the Houston Rockets in the Western Conference semifinals.

Kevin won’t play tomorrow,” Kerr said. “But he’s ramping up his exercise routine, his workouts.” 

Klay Thompson is ruled questionable for the game as he suffered a mild hamstring strain in Game 2. Andre Iguodala wil play in Game 3. Kevon Looney has a fractured collarbone, and he won’t play until the end of the season.

“Klay said he’ll be fine, but Klay could be half dead and he would say he would be fine,” Kerr said a couple of days ago. “We’ll see. He pulled his hamstring. He thinks it is minor, so I don’t know what that means going forward.”

“I caught up with Klay Thompson on the way out of the arena,” Mark Medina tweeted.” Klay about his hamstring: ‘I’m good. It’s just tight.’ Does Klay think he’ll play in Game 3? Klay: ‘Honestly, it’s hard to say. Thank God we got a couple of days off. But I think I’ll be good to go.’”

If you ask Thompson, he is all-in when it comes to playing.

”It will be a game-time decision. But for me personally, it would be hard to see me not playing. Hopefully, I’ll feel much better tomorrow and be a go for tipoff,” Thompson said.

When it comes to Looney, the season is over.

”He’s had such a great season, such a great postseason run,” coach Kerr said. ”Fortunately it won’t affect his future, but it’s a big loss for us.”

Will Thompson and Durant leave the Warriors this summer?

“’The season is still ongoing,’ Lacob said in a recent interview when asked about Thompson’s future with the team. ‘We are not finished. I have no new ideas or data for you. We love Klay and KD and intend to attempt to re-sign them. Period. I am confident about BOTH of them.’”
